1 Introduction
Interface to import input data in the MBF format (Model Batch File) of CAEPIPE (SST Systems, Inc.) into
ROHR2.

2 Task
The interface enables to import CAEPIPE model batch files (*.mbf). This file type is created by an export
function of CAEPIPE. The data of the CAEPIPE model is directly imported into ROHR2.

3 Interface handling
Requirements of the data transfer into ROHR2
a current program license of ROHR2
To read CAEPIPE files in the format *.mbf) use the File| Open command in ROHR2
Selected file type must be CAEPIPE.

4 Data format
The import of von CAEPIPE files is expected in accordance with the specification of the MBF format in the
CAEPIPE manual. Required file extension is *.mbf.

5 Data to be converted
The following sections in the MBF files will be considered:
- OPTIONS
- MATERIAL
- SOILS
- PIPE
- LOADS
- LAYOUT
Data for structural steel sections and jacket pipes are not considered.

5.1 OPTIONS
In the OPTIONS section settings for hanger design, piping code, units and vertical axis are defined.
The manufacturer for hanger design is always set to GRINNELL (the default setting in CAEPIPE).

5.2 MATERIAL
The material definitions are imported as user defined data into the ROHR2 model. The parameters Long.
Joint factor and Circ. Joint Factor are ignored.

5.3 SOILS
From soil properties only the soil cover height is considered. In the ROHR2 model soil restraint acc. to EN
13941 with the here defined soil cover height is created.

5.4 PIPE
For each PIPE definition a pipe dimension record is created. The parameters Lining density and Lining
Thk are ignored.

5.5 LOADS
According to the data in LOADS the appropriate number of load cases of the type Operation are created.
The operation data from loads are assigned to these load cases. The load case Dead weight gets the
same operation data as the first load case operation.
If the Additional weight is greater than 0 a line load is created for the ROHR2 model.

5.6.4

Supports

From the restraint data of CAEPIPE supports for ROHR2 are created. ROHR2 tries to combine the
different restraint at one node to create only one support in the ROHR2 model. If this is not possible
several supports for groups of restraints are created. In this case new intermediate nodes are created
during the import of the data. If displacements (DIS) are defined here these displacements are applied to
all for this node created supports in the ROHR2 model.
